ComfyUI-Manager终极问题解决指南:从新手到高手
【免费下载链接】ComfyUI-Manager项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I-Manager
你是否在使用ComfyUI-Manager时遇到过各种奇怪的问题?安装失败、节点冲突、依赖错误...这些看似复杂的问题其实都有简单的解决方法。本指南将带你从零开始,逐步掌握ComfyUI-Manager的各种故障排除技巧。
五大常见问题类型及快速诊断
在使用ComfyUI-Manager的过程中,我们通常会遇到以下几种类型的问题:
安装类问题:无法正常安装或更新ComfyUI-Manager依赖类问题:Python包版本冲突或缺失节点类问题:自定义节点冲突或无法加载网络类问题:下载超时或SSL证书错误配置类问题:路径设置错误或权限不足
安装问题的全面解决方案
正确安装路径设置
安装ComfyUI-Manager时,最常见的错误就是路径设置不正确。正确的安装路径应该是:
cd ComfyUI/custom_nodes git clone https://gitcode.com/gh_mirrors/co/ComfyUI-Manager comfyui-manager注意:不要将压缩包直接解压到custom_nodes目录,也不要出现嵌套的目录结构。安装完成后,确保custom_nodes目录下直接包含comfyui-manager文件夹及其内容。
便携版本特殊处理
对于便携式ComfyUI版本,需要额外的安装步骤:
- 首先确保系统已安装Git
- 下载install-manager-for-portable-version.bat脚本
- 将脚本放置到ComfyUI_windows_portable目录
- 双击运行批处理文件完成安装
网络环境优化
如果遇到网络连接问题,可以尝试以下方法:
- 设置Git镜像加速:
git config --global url."https://mirror.ghproxy.com/".insteadOf "https://" - 配置环境变量:
GITHUB_ENDPOINT=https://mirror.ghproxy.com/https://github.com - 对于Hugging Face资源:
HF_ENDPOINT=https://hf-mirror.com
依赖冲突的智能处理
自动依赖修复
ComfyUI-Manager提供了强大的依赖管理功能。当遇到依赖冲突时,可以使用命令行工具进行修复:
# 修复特定节点的依赖 python cm-cli.py fix 节点名称 # 更新所有节点到最新版本 python cm-cli.py update all # 查看当前依赖状态 python cm-cli.py show dependencies版本锁定机制
为了防止特定包被意外降级,可以在配置文件中设置保护列表:
[downgrade_blacklist] packages = diffusers, kornia, torchvision节点冲突的深度解析
冲突原因分析
节点冲突通常是由于不同扩展包中定义了相同名称的节点类。ComfyUI在加载时会遇到命名冲突,导致部分节点无法正常工作。
冲突解决方案
方案一:优先级管理在ComfyUI-Manager界面中,找到冲突节点并设置加载优先级。高优先级节点将覆盖低优先级节点。
方案二:选择性禁用如果某个节点的功能可以被其他节点替代,可以直接禁用该节点:
python cm-cli.py disable 冲突节点名称方案三:版本协调尝试更新冲突节点到最新版本,开发者可能已经解决了兼容性问题。
网络和SSL问题的专业处理
SSL证书绕过
在受限制的网络环境中,如果遇到SSL证书验证失败,可以修改配置文件:
[network] bypass_ssl = True git_exe = /usr/bin/git下载加速配置
对于大文件下载,可以启用Aria2下载器来提升下载速度:
[download] use_aria2 = True max_connections = 16命令行工具的实战应用
基础操作命令
# 查看已安装节点 python cm-cli.py show installed # 安装新节点 python cm-cli.py install 节点名称 # 卸载不需要的节点 python cm-cli.py uninstall 节点名称高级维护功能
快照管理:
# 创建系统快照 python cm-cli.py create-snapshot # 恢复快照状态 python cm-cli.py restore-snapshot 快照文件路径 # 列出所有快照 python cm-cli.py list-snapshots批量操作:
# 批量更新所有节点 python cm-cli.py update all # 批量修复所有节点 python cm-cli.py fix all配置文件详解与优化
核心配置文件
ComfyUI-Manager的主要配置文件位于:ComfyUI/user/default/ComfyUI-Manager/config.ini
关键配置项
[general] auto_update = True backup_enabled = True [security] ssl_verification = False checksum_validation = True [performance] parallel_downloads = 4 cache_enabled = True故障排查流程
系统化排查步骤
- 检查安装路径:确认ComfyUI-Manager位于正确的custom_nodes目录下
- 验证依赖状态:使用命令行工具检查Python包版本
- 分析错误日志:查看ComfyUI启动日志中的具体错误信息
- 尝试基础修复:运行
python cm-cli.py fix all进行自动修复 - 手动干预:如自动修复失败,根据错误信息进行针对性处理
紧急恢复方案
如果系统出现严重问题,无法正常启动:
- 使用命令行工具创建快照(如果之前没有创建)
- 禁用最近安装的节点
- 恢复之前的快照状态
- 逐步重新安装需要的节点
预防性维护建议
定期维护操作
- 每周检查节点更新
- 每月创建系统快照
- 定期清理不需要的节点
- 备份重要的工作流配置
最佳实践指南
- 安装前检查:在安装新节点前,查看其兼容性和依赖要求
- 版本控制:记录每个节点的版本信息,便于问题追踪
- 测试环境:在正式使用前,在测试环境中验证新节点
- 文档记录:记录自定义配置和修改,便于后续维护
通过本指南的学习,相信你已经掌握了ComfyUI-Manager的各种问题解决方法。记住,大多数问题都有标准化的解决方案,关键是要按照正确的流程进行操作。如果遇到无法解决的问题,可以查阅官方文档或在相关社区寻求帮助。
【免费下载链接】ComfyUI-Manager项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I-Manager
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考